Tolerable failure level for net zero innovation Framework remains undefined by DESNZ.
Recommendation
The uncertain and longer-term nature of innovation makes some level of failure inevitable.48 DESNZ, however, has yet to define what level of failure it could tolerate across the Framework, instead placing reliance on risk management by departments at programme and project level.49 The business case for each innovation programme includes a risk statement that needs to be consistent with a department’s overall risk appetite, which we were told ranges from medium to very high. DESNZ told us that it funds some high-risk projects and deliberately takes a range of risks to maximise the returns across its portfolio of projects.50
